T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to lathe tool detection field, specifically, relate to a lathe broken tool detection device and lathe. BACKGROUND
[0002] In today's mechanical processing industry, broken tool detection is crucial to ensure production safety and improve production efficiency. In the prior art, non-contact laser broken tool detection is widely used because they can provide reliable and efficient broken tool detection function, for example, Chinese patent CN115890343B, in which the laser emitted by the laser sensor is reflected by the tool tip for broken tool detection. However, such detection devices have the problem of high cost, and have high requirements for installation and operating environment, especially for the detection of small tools and the stability in the vibration environment of the machine tool. Machine tool vibration can easily affect the detection result. In addition, since most of these devices are installed inside the machine tool, cutting fluid can easily contact them during machine tool processing. Long-term contact with cutting fluid poses a challenge to its service life and affects its service life.
[0003] On the contrary, some machine tools use contact broken tool detection devices installed on the tool magazine protective sheet metal or other sheet metal. Such devices are easy to install and have relatively low cost. However, due to the weak rigidity and poor shock resistance of the protective sheet metal, the environmental requirements are more stringent. Specifically, even a short period of improper installation adjustment or deformation of the protective sheet metal will significantly affect the accuracy of the broken tool detection result.
[0004] Based on the above, the broken tool detection devices in the prior art have advantages but also obvious shortcomings. Although non-contact laser detection has superior performance, it is complex to install, has high cost, and vibration can easily affect the detection result; while the contact detection device is easy to install and has low cost, its structural stability and environmental adaptability still need to be improved. Therefore, a broken tool detection device that has efficient detection function and simplifies installation and improves stability is needed to meet the actual needs of the modern mechanical processing industry for broken tool detection devices. [0038] See also Figures 1 to 3 , one aspect of the present invention provides a broken tool detection device for a machine tool, the machine tool includes a tool magazine 3 and a machine tool control system 9, a plurality of tool clamps 32 for mounting a tool 4 are provided on the tool magazine 3, the broken tool detection device includes a mounting bracket 1 and a broken tool detection module 2, the mounting bracket 1 is installed on the tool magazine 3; the broken tool detection module 2 includes a fixed seat 21 fixed on the mounting bracket 1, a rotating unit 22 rotatably arranged on the fixed seat 21, a racket 23 arranged at the end of the rotating unit 22 and a detection unit 24 for detecting the rotation angle of the rotating unit 22, the racket 23 rotates around the fixed seat 21 in a preset detection plane through the rotating unit 22, and the installation axis of at least one tool clamp 32 of the tool magazine 3 is located in the preset detection plane; wherein the detection unit 24 is communicatively connected to the machine tool control system 9, and is used to feedback the r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 when the racket 23 contacts the tip of the tool 4, and the machine tool control system 9 is used to receive the rotation angle and output a broken tool detection result signal.
[0039] In the present invention, a mounting bracket 1 is mounted on a tool magazine 3, a tool breakage detection module 2 is mounted on the mounting bracket 1, and a slap bar 23 is used to detect tool breakage by rotating to contact the tip of a tool 4 on the tool magazine 3. Mounting the mounting bracket 1 on the tool magazine 3 provides greater stability than mounting it on the protective sheet metal of the tool magazine 3, thereby reducing the probability of failure of the tool breakage detection device due to vibration of the machine tool.
[0040] The broken tool detection device can effectively detect the breakage of the tool 4 during the machining process of the machine tool, ensuring the safety and accuracy of the machining. Specifically, the broken tool detection device fixes the broken tool detection module 2 by means of a mounting bracket 1 installed on the tool magazine 3. The broken tool detection module 2 includes a rotating unit 22 that rotates around a fixed seat 21, and a clapper 23 connected to the rotating unit 22, and the clapper 23 can rotate freely within a preset detection plane. When the tool 4 breaks and shifts, the clapper 23 contacts the tool tip, and the r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 changes. The detection unit 24 monitors this change in real time and feeds back to the machine tool control system 9 to know whether the current tool 4 is broken.
[0041] In one embodiment, reference Figures 1 to 3, the broken tool detection module 2 is installed on the tool magazine 3 through the adjustable mounting bracket 1, the extension direction of the knocking rod 23 is perpendicular to the rotation axis of the rotating unit 22 and the axis direction of the tool 4, and the machine tool control system 9 comprises an alarm module 91, which is used for alarming when the machine tool control system 9 judges that the tool is broken. Specifically, when the broken tool detection needs to be performed, the knocking rod 23 rotates in the preset detection plane until the tool tip of the tool 4 is contacted. At this time, the rotating unit 22 rotates, and the detection unit 24 can detect the r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 in real time. The detection unit 24 is in communication connection with the machine tool control system 9, and the detected r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 is fed back to the machine tool control system 9. When the machine tool control system 9 judges that the tool is broken, the alarm module 91 contained in the machine tool control system 9 will alarm. The alarm mode can be to issue an audible and light alarm signal, for example, to flash an indicator light on the machine tool operation panel and issue a buzzing sound, so as to remind the operator to handle the broken tool in time, so as to avoid affecting the normal operation of the machine tool and the machining quality.
[0042] In one embodiment, reference is made to Figures 1 to 3 The machine tool control system 9 stores the standard r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 corresponding to the tool 4 installed on each tool holder 32 of the tool magazine 3, and the standard length can be obtained through pre-measurement and calibration. The machine tool control system 9 is used to compare the received real-time rotation angle with the standard rotation angle to obtain a broken tool detection result signal.
[0043] The machine tool control system 9 stores the standard length of the tool 4 installed on each tool holder 32 of the tool magazine 3, and the machine tool control system 9 is used to obtain the real-time length of the tool 4 according to the received real-time rotation angle and the distance between the broken tool detection module 2 and the tool 4 to obtain a broken tool detection result signal.
[0044] The following is a specific description of the broken tool judgment based on the standard rotation angle and the broken tool judgment based on the length calculation of the tool 4:
[0045] Specific description of the broken tool judgment based on the standard rotation angle:
[0046] The machine tool control system 9 pre-stores the standard rotation angle of the rotating unit 22 corresponding to the tool 4 installed on each tool holder 32 of the tool magazine 3. These standard rotation angles are obtained through pre-detection and calibration when the tool 4 is complete and in a normal installation state.
[0047] After receiving the real-time rotation angle fed back by the detection unit 24, the machine tool control system 9 compares the real-time rotation angle with the standard rotation angle of the corresponding tool 4 pre-stored. If there is a significant difference (for example, exceeding the set error range) between the real-time rotation angle and the standard rotation angle, the machine tool control system 9 judges that the tool may be broken, and outputs a broken tool detection result signal.
[0048] Specific description of broken tool judgment based on tool 4 length calculation:
[0049] The machine tool control system 9 stores the standard length of the tool 4 installed on each tool holder 32 of the tool magazine 3. These standard lengths can be obtained through pre-measurement and calibration. The machine tool control system 9 calculates the real-time length of the tool 4 according to the received real-time rotation angle, the distance between the broken tool detection module 2 and the tool 4, and other information, according to a specific algorithm. Then compare the calculated real-time length with the pre-stored standard length of the corresponding tool 4, if there is a significant difference (such as exceeding the set error range), it is judged that the tool may be broken, and the broken tool detection result signal is output.
[0050] In the broken tool detection device of the present application, after the control system receives the rotation angle signal, it is compared with the pre-stored standard angle, and when it exceeds the preset range, it is judged as a broken tool, and timely alarm is given through the alarm module 91, thereby avoiding production accidents and product quality problems caused by broken tools. In addition, the device also supports the configuration of different tool 4 standard lengths and detection heights, and measures the real-time tool 4 length, further improving the accuracy and reliability of the broken tool detection. Through such design, the device can flexibly adjust the installation position and provide comprehensive safety protection, improving the stability and processing efficiency of the machine tool.
[0051] In one embodiment, referring to Figure 1 and Figure 2 , the mounting bracket 1 includes a tool magazine bracket 11, an intermediate bracket 12, and a detection bracket 13, wherein the tool magazine bracket 11 is adjustably mounted on the tool magazine 3; the intermediate bracket 12 is adjustably mounted on the tool magazine bracket 11 along the X-axis direction and the Z-axis direction; the detection bracket 13 is adjustably arranged on the intermediate bracket 12 along the Y-axis direction, and the fixing seat 21 is mounted on the detection bracket 13. Specifically, the broken tool detection module 2 is mounted on the detection bracket 13. In actual use, the tool magazine bracket 11 is an adjustable component, which can be mounted on the tool magazine 3 of the machine tool, so that the position of the mounting bracket 1 as a whole relative to the tool magazine 3 can be adjusted along the X-axis direction and the Z-axis direction as needed. The position of the mounting bracket 1 can not only be adjusted in the X-axis direction, but also in the Z-axis direction, enhancing the flexibility and adaptability of the device. In addition, the detection bracket 13 can adjust the position in the Y-axis direction, ensuring the accuracy and adaptability during the detection process. At the same time, the fixing seat 21 is mounted on this detection bracket 13, indicating that the position of the fixing seat 21 can be adjusted to a suitable position according to the detection requirements, so as to better implement the broken tool detection function.
[0052] Further, in a specific embodiment, referring to Figure 1 and Figure 2The tool magazine support 11 is L-shaped, comprising a first horizontal plate 111 and a first vertical plate 112 perpendicular to the first horizontal plate 111. A plurality of first fastening holes 113 are arranged on the first horizontal plate 111 along the X-axis direction, for installing and adjusting the position of the tool magazine support 11. Specifically, a hole is arranged on the tool magazine 3 to match the first fastening hole 113, and the first vertical plate 112 is adjusted so that the hole at the appropriate position on the first vertical plate 112 matches the hole on the tool magazine 3, to adjust the position of the tool magazine support 11. A plurality of second fastening holes 114 are arranged on the first vertical plate 112 along the Z-axis direction, for installing and adjusting the position of the intermediate support 12. The structure of the tool magazine support 11 can also be a direction plate structure, in which the second fastening holes 114 are arranged in a row on the direction plate, so that the intermediate support can be adjusted in position along the X-axis direction and the Y-axis direction.
[0053] The intermediate support 12 comprises a second horizontal plate 121 and a second vertical plate 122 perpendicular to the second horizontal plate 121, and the second vertical plate 122 is provided with third fastening holes 123, and the second horizontal plate 121 is provided with a plurality of fourth fastening holes 124 along the Y-axis direction;
[0054] The detection support 13 comprises a third horizontal plate 131 and a third vertical plate 132 perpendicular to the third horizontal plate 131, and the third horizontal plate 131 is provided with fifth fastening holes 133, and the third vertical plate 132 is provided with sixth fastening holes 134, and the fixing seat 21 is provided with seventh fastening holes 25. The fixing seat 21 is installed on the detection support 13.
[0055] In order to fix the parts of the mounting support 1 in place, with reference to Figure 1 and Figure 2 , the mounting support 1 further comprises:
[0056] The first fastening member 5 is used to install the tool magazine support 11 in the tool magazine 3, and the installation is achieved by inserting the first fastening member 5 into the first fastening hole 113. Specifically, the first fastening member 5 is aligned with the hole on the tool magazine 3, and the first fastening member 5 is inserted into the first fastening hole 113 to install the tool magazine support 11 on the tool magazine 3. When it is necessary to adjust the position of the tool magazine support 11, another first fastening hole 113 of the tool magazine support 11 is aligned with the hole on the tool magazine 3, and then the first fastening member 5 is inserted to achieve the position adjustment.
[0057] Second fastener 6: used for installing the intermediate support 12 on the tool magazine support 11, the installation is achieved by inserting the second fastener 6 into the second fastening hole 114 and the third fastening hole 123. Specifically, the third fastening hole 123 on the intermediate support 12 is aligned with the second fastening hole 114 on the tool magazine support 11, and then the second fastener 6 is inserted into the second fastening hole 114 and the third fastening hole 123 to install the intermediate support 12 on the tool magazine support 11. When the position of the intermediate support 12 needs to be adjusted, the third fastening hole 123 is aligned with other second fastening holes 114, and then the second fastener 6 is inserted for fastening to achieve position adjustment.
[0058] Third fastener 7: used for installing the detection support 13 on the intermediate support 12, the installation is achieved by inserting the third fastener 7 into the fourth fastening hole 124 and the fifth fastening hole 133. Specifically, a plurality of fourth fastening holes 124 are arranged on the second transverse plate 121 along the Y-axis direction, and the fifth fastening hole 133 of the detection support 13 is aligned with the fourth fastening hole 124, and then the third fastener 7 is inserted into the fourth fastening hole 124 and the fifth fastening hole 133. Similarly, when the position of the detection support 13 needs to be adjusted, the fifth fastening hole 133 is paired with other fourth fastening holes 124. In addition, the fifth fastening hole 133 is provided as a waist-shaped structure hole with the length along the Y-axis direction, which makes the fifth fastening hole 133 not need to be paired with other fourth fastening holes 124 to adjust the position. That is, when the position needs to be adjusted, the third fastener 7 is loosened, and then the detection support 13 is moved along the Y-axis direction, and the waist-shaped fifth fastening hole 133 provides a moving space for the third fastener 7, which makes the position adjustment of the detection support 13 more convenient.
[0059] Fourth fastener 8: used for installing the fixed seat 21 on the detection support 13, the installation is achieved by inserting the fourth fastener 8 into the sixth fastening hole 134 and the seventh fastening hole 25 on the fixed seat 21. The fixed seat 21 is installed on the detection support 13 by inserting the fourth fastener 8 into the sixth fastening hole 134 and the seventh fastening hole 25. The sixth fastening hole 134 is a waist-shaped structure hole with the length along the X-axis direction, when the position of the broken tool detection module 2 relative to the intermediate support 12 needs to be adjusted, the fourth fastener 8 is loosened, and then the fixed seat 21 is moved along the Y-axis direction, and the waist-shaped fifth fastening hole 133 provides a moving space for the fourth fastener 8, which makes the position adjustment of the detection support 13 more convenient.
[0060] The intermediate support 12 is mounted on the tool magazine support 11, the position of the intermediate support 12 can be adjusted along the X-axis direction and the Z-axis direction, and the position of the broken tool detection module 2 can be adjusted along the Y-axis direction, through the multi-level and multi-dimensional adjustment mechanism, the broken tool detection device can meet different working requirements and installation conditions, the detection flexibility of the broken tool detection module 2 is greatly increased, and the adaptability and practicality in different application scenarios are improved.
[0061] In one embodiment, referring to Figure 1 and Figure 2 , the first vertical plate 112 is provided with a first sliding rail (not shown in the figure), and the second vertical plate 122 is movably arranged on the first sliding rail; the second horizontal plate 121 is provided with a second sliding rail (not shown in the figure), and the third horizontal plate 131 is movably arranged on the second sliding rail. When it is necessary to adjust the position of the intermediate support 12, the second fastener 6 is taken down, the first vertical plate 112 can slide along the first sliding rail, and the first sliding rail is arranged to provide a guide function for the movement of the first vertical plate 112, and along the guide rail, the movement of the first vertical plate 112 is more convenient. When it is necessary to adjust the position of the detection support 13, the third fastener 7 is taken down, and then the detection support 13 is moved along the second guide rail, and the principle is the same as that of the intermediate support 12 along the first guide rail, which will not be repeated here.
